Story of the Drama Queen : The Drama Queen's Grand Performance

In the bustling city of Artville, there was a theater unlike any other, known simply as "The Grand Stage." At its heart lived a theatrical legend known far and wide as the Drama Queen. She was neither a queen by birth nor by title, but by sheer dramatic prowess.

The Drama Queen, whose real name was Eliza, was an extraordinary actress with a flair for the dramatic that was second to none. With her expressive gestures, melodramatic expressions, and an uncanny ability to steal the spotlight, she had the power to turn even the most mundane of scenes into unforgettable spectacles.

Eliza's obsession with drama began at a young age. She would don bedsheet robes, tiara askew, and perform dramatic monologues to her stuffed animal audience, often eliciting peals of laughter from her family. As she grew older, her passion for the stage intensified, and she joined The Grand Stage's troupe, quickly becoming its brightest star.

One evening, as the theater's manager fretted over a lackluster script and dwindling ticket sales, Eliza approached him with a glimmer in her eye. She had a grand vision, an idea so audacious it was bound to breathe new life into the theater. With her persuasive charm, she convinced the manager to give her creative control over the next production.

The Drama Queen's magnum opus was titled "The Enchanted Masquerade," a whimsical tale of love, intrigue, and mistaken identities. The rehearsals were a sight to behold, with Eliza's dramatic directions causing both laughter and exasperation among the cast and crew.

On opening night, the theater was packed to capacity. The anticipation in the air was palpable, and murmurs of "The Drama Queen's grand production" circulated through the audience. As the curtains rose, Eliza's performance was nothing short of spectacular.

Every line was delivered with exaggerated passion, every movement imbued with theatrical intensity. When she wept, the audience wept; when she laughed, they laughed; when she gasped, they gasped. It was as if they were swept away into the world of the play, captivated by the sheer force of Eliza's dramatic prowess.

The Drama Queen's performance left the audience in stitches, but it was also filled with moments of genuine emotion that moved them to tears. The standing ovation that followed was thunderous, and it seemed as though the entire city had come to celebrate Eliza's remarkable talent.

"The Enchanted Masquerade" became a sensation, playing to sold-out audiences night after night. Eliza's unique brand of drama had reinvigorated The Grand Stage, and the theater's fortunes were forever changed.

But as the final curtain fell on the production, the Drama Queen knew that her work was done. She had accomplished her grand vision, leaving an indelible mark on the world of theater. She gracefully stepped back into the shadows, content in the knowledge that her dramatic legacy would live on.

And so, the Drama Queen, who had once been a young girl performing for stuffed animals, had become a legend of the stage, leaving behind a city forever enchanted by her dramatic magic. Eliza's story was one of passion, creativity, and the transformative power of drama, proving that sometimes, a little bit of theatrical flair can change the world.
